SCENE V:

(THE OFFICERS ARE STILL EXAMINING JOSH'S BODY AND A CROWD OF PEOPLE ARE STANDING AROUND, BEING INTERVIEWED BY OTHER OFFICERS. AN OFFICER WALKS IN FROM THE EXIT ALONG WITH BEN AND GRACE.)

BEN: "This is an outrage, I have an important meeting to get to!"

OFFICER: "I'm sorry sir, but until we find out who the killer is, no one gets out of this building."

GRACE (TO BEN): "Well, that's great, Ben, we can work out the kinks in our relationship."

BEN (TO THE OFFICER): "Would it help if I said I was the killer?"

OFFICER: "Are you?"

BEN: "No."

OFFICER: "Then no. Please have a seat at the bar sir, this could take a while."

GRACE: "Come on, Ben."

(BEN IS RELUCTANTLY DRAGGED OFF TO THE BAR BY GRACE. MEANWHILE, WILL IS STANDING OVER JOSH'S BODY, STARING DOWN AT IT.)

WILL: "Come on, wake up again, I need to know who killed you."

(WILL WAITS. JOSH REMAINS DEAD.)

WILL: "Damn."

(WILL WALKS AWAY AND HEADS OVER TO THE BAR WHERE JACK HAS JUST SERVED GRACE AND BEN THEIR DRINKS. JACK GIVES GRACE A WEIRD LOOK, THEN NOTICES WILL STARING AT HIM.)

JACK: "What'll it be?"

WILL: "Uh, nothing, thanks. You are aware that someone just died here, aren't you?"

JACK: "Yeah."

WILL: "And that doesn't bother you?"

JACK: "Nah, Josh couldn't really play the piano anyway. Besides, all these officers here means we get more drink orders, which means more money."

WILL (SUSPICIOUSLY): "Uh-hu. Well, would you mind if I asked you a few questions?"

JACK: "Depends what kind of questions."

WILL (TAKING OUT HIS PEN AND PAPER): "First off, was Josh well liked here? Did he have any enemies, or people that just didn't like him?"

JACK: "Well, no one really liked him, but not enough to kill him, if that's what you mean."

WILL: "Okay, next question: what's the deal with the lights? Why'd they go out?"

JACK: "Some clumsy maid accidentally dusted the power switch. Don't worry, her ass has been fired for that."

WILL (RAISING AN EYEBROW): "I thought you said it was a power outage."

JACK (FLUSTERED): "I did? When? Oh...well, I was just saying that to cover up for her mistake."

WILL (STILL SUSPICIOUS): "Sure. And you don't think it's any coincidence that the lights went off around the time Josh was murdered?"

JACK (MORE FLUSTERED): "I dunno, why you asking me? I didn't do it."

WILL: "I never said you did, Mr. Black. I can see this is making you nervous, though, so I'll change the subject. What kind of club is 'The Boys Club'?"

JACK: "Well, look around, what kind of a club do you think it is? It's a typical bar and dance club, like a million others in New York."

WILL: "And you co-own this bar with Karen Walker? What can you tell me about her?"

JACK: "She's the best damn singer in all the free world for one thing. She's the reason half these people come here. And she didn't kill Josh either, so don't go accusing her too."

WILL: "Mr. Black, I haven't mentioned that at all, yet you've denied it twice."

JACK (FLUSTERED): "Uh...well, uh, I guess I'm just more shaken up than I thought about this murder." (TWO OFFICERS APPROACH THE BAR.) "Oh, more customers, sorry detective, the rest of that interview will have to wait."

(JACK QUICKLY WALKS OVER TO THE OFFICERS AND TAKES THEIR ORDERS, THEN DISAPPEARS INTO THE BACK. WILL SITS AT THE BAR, LOOKING OVER HIS NOTES.)

WILL (VOICE-OVER): "The bartender was hiding something, I felt sure of it. Why would he repeatedly deny committing the murder? Was he really just spooked, or was it something else? I was going to keep my eye on him. In the meantime, I figured I'd better investigate the club some more, and talk to Jack's partner, Karen. I was determined to get to the bottom of this."
